syscall: cap RLIMIT_NOFILE soft limit in TestRlimit on darwin

On some machines, kern.maxfilesperproc is 4096. If Rlimit.Cur is larger
than that, Setrlimit will get an errEINVAL.

Fixes #40564.

@ -336,11 +336,11 @@ func TestRlimit(t *testing.T) {
}
set := rlimit
set.Cur = set.Max - 1
if runtime.GOOS == "darwin" && set.Cur > 10240 {
// The max file limit is 10240, even though
// the max returned by Getrlimit is 1<<63-1.
// This is OPEN_MAX in sys/syslimits.h.
set.Cur = 10240
if runtime.GOOS == "darwin" && set.Cur > 4096 {
// rlim_min for RLIMIT_NOFILE should be equal to
// or lower than kern.maxfilesperproc, which on
// some machines are 4096. See #40564.
set.Cur = 4096
}
